The Human Brain Is Wired to Notice Faces

Eye-tracking research has shown that people naturally focus on human faces almost immediately. Before reading a headline or noticing a product, our brains instinctively search for other people.

This is an evolutionary trait that marketers can use to create stronger visual communication.

Even more interesting, people tend to follow another person's gaze. If someone in a photo is looking toward a product, headline, or call-to-action, viewers are much more likely to look there as well. Reach out to ecomko today!

This creates a natural visual path:

Face → Eyes → Product → Message → Call-to-Action

Instead of forcing attention, great imagery guides it.

Authentic Beats Perfect

Consumers have become remarkably skilled at recognizing overly polished stock photography.

Images that feel staged, generic, or artificial often fail to create an emotional connection.

Authentic lifestyle photography creates something much more valuable: trust.

Whether it's customers enjoying a product, employees interacting with one another, or creators sharing genuine experiences, real moments help audiences imagine themselves becoming part of the story.

That emotional connection often leads to stronger engagement and higher conversion rates.

Local Context Makes Brands More Relatable

One trend we've consistently observed is that recognizable community locations often outperform generic backgrounds.

When people recognize a neighborhood, landmark, local event, or familiar environment, the brand immediately feels more relevant.

For regional businesses, tourism brands, nonprofits, educational organizations, and retail companies, incorporating local settings into photography can increase familiarity and strengthen community connection.

Instead of showing "a coffee shop," show your neighborhood coffee shop.

Instead of a generic park, feature a well-known local gathering place.

These subtle details help transform advertisements into stories.

Lifestyle Images Tell a Story

Consumers rarely purchase products because of specifications alone.

They purchase because they can imagine themselves using them.

A hiking backpack becomes more compelling when someone is standing on a mountain.

A kitchen appliance feels more valuable when a family is gathered around dinner.

An educational organization feels more trustworthy when students, teachers, and families are actively participating in real experiences.

The product becomes part of a larger story.

That's what lifestyle photography delivers.

Practical Tips for Better Marketing Photography

When planning your next campaign, consider these guidelines:

• Use real customers whenever possible.
• Capture authentic emotions instead of posed smiles.
• Include recognizable local landmarks when appropriate.
• Show products being used naturally.
• Avoid overly polished stock photography.
• Direct subjects' gaze toward your headline or product.
• Focus on storytelling rather than simply displaying products.
